The interviewer wants to learn about your background and your passion for biochemistry. There are many different paths that can lead to a career in science and the interviewer is looking to see if your interests match what they're looking for in a new hire.

Respond to this question by highlighting your genuine excitement for some of the fundamental components of the industry, in-depth laboratory-based research, or applying your knowledge to everyday issues. Based on your thoughtful answer, the interviewer will discover that you are serious about the profession and this employment opportunity.

"I decided to become a Biochemist after taking several AP science courses in high school and advanced labs in college. I found Biochemistry to be the most interesting of all of the sciences because it combines chemistry, biology, and physiology, covering the basic needs of life and the important role in maintaining health and nutrition in people's lives."
